The Ministry of Internal Affairs and Communications (MIC) and The Association for Promotion of Digital Broadcasting (hereinafter, “Dpa”) have decided to provide temporary use of satellite broadcasting as a countermeasure against poor reception of terrestrial digital broadcasting for households that lack digitalization support due to unavoidable situations caused by delays in antenna construction, etc. Applications will be accepted as of June 1 (Wed), 2011.
The Ministry of Internal Affairs and Communications (MIC) and Dpa have now decided to provide temporary use (refer to enclosed documents) of satellite broadcasting as a countermeasure against poor reception of terrestrial digital broadcasting (used by the Dpa since March 2010) to households (including non-household facilities) that will not be able to receive terrestrial digital broadcasting once analog broadcasting has been terminated, due to delays in antenna construction, etc., and applications will be accepted from June 1 (Wed), 2011.
Households covered by temporary use and the application procedure, etc. are as follows.
Persons in the disaster-affected Iwate, Miyagi and Fukushima prefectures and the surrounding areas, who have become unable to view television due to the effects of the Eastern Japan Great Earthquake Disaster have also been provided with “temporary use” (hereinafter, “'temporary use' in disaster-affected areas”) since April 7, 2011, and this provision will continue uninterrupted.
1. Households covered, etc.
Households that will not be able to receive terrestrial digital broadcasting once analog broadcasting has been terminated, due to delays in antenna construction, etc.
2. Temporarily available contents (main items)
(1) Free of charge viewing of broadcasting that is normally received in households, as well as programs from the same system of terrestrial digital broadcasting in the Tokyo district
(2) Viewing will be possible for approximately six months (at the end of the viewing period the the image will automatically be scrambled to prevent further viewing), although this period maybe lengthened as necessary in disaster-affected areas, etc.
(3) BS antennas, BS digital broadcasting-compatible televisions, and tuners necessary for receiving BS digital broadcasting are to be arranged at one's own expense
3. Application process, etc.
(1) Please apply by sending the prescribed application form to the Dpa information center for satellite broadcasting as a countermeasure against poor reception of terrestrial digital broadcasting.
Please note that while application forms are to be mailed from the appropriate reception center, they will also be available at local self-governing bodies, consumer electronics stores and Digi-Support Centers.
(2) As a general rule, the period for acceptance of applications will run from June 1 (Wed) to July 31 (Sun), 2011.
However, the period for acceptance of applications in Iwate, Miyagi and Fukushima prefectures will run until the analog broadcasting termination dates in these regions.
